    Re: Pages help

    the easiest way is to do this:

    tornwar.x10hosting.com/index => put a file called "index.html" in the folder /public_html/index/
    tornwar.x10hosting.com/home => put a file called "index.html" in the folder /public_html/home/
    etc.

    This makes a pretty ugly solution. Anytime you want to add a new page you have to create a new folder and complete new page. This is the big limitation of using strictly only HTML.

    Now, if we do something like this

    tornwar.x10hosting.com/index => is the same as tornwar.x10hosting.com/index.php?page=index
    tornwar.x10hosting.com/home => is the same as tornwar.x10hosting.com/index.php?page=home

    Which is quite a bit cleaner. We do this through PHP and htaccess.

    So, the choice is yours. Learn two new programming languages, or do what is easier to implement, but harder to change.
